Condition: Dyslexia · Sponsor: The Hong Kong Polytechnic University
Developmental dyslexia is a common and serious specific learning disability affecting up to one in eight children in Hong Kong, with profound consequences for academic success and personal well-being. For children learning to read the visually complex Chinese script, the challenge is particularly intense. A key research challenge is a long-standing "chicken-and-egg" debate: are weaknesses in the brain's fast-processing visual system (Magnocellular-Dorsal deficits) a cause of reading difficulties, or merely a consequence of limited reading practice? This uncertainty has constrained theoretical progress, creating a major barrier to developing effective, evidence-based support for struggling readers beyond traditional linguistic-based methods. This project is designed to resolve this debate by directly testing if training a core visual-attentional skill can causally improve reading. The approach is built on investigator's strong pilot data, which established a novel "Neurocognitive Cascade Model": a framework suggesting that the integrity of foundational visual processing impacts reading through a sequential chain reaction flowing from visual attention to working memory. To test the model, investigators will employ a rigorous, assessor-blind randomized controlled trial with 100 Cantonese-speaking children with developmental dyslexia.
